Financial Performance and Transformation:
- Comtech reported consolidated net sales of $126.6 million in Q2 of fiscal 2025, down from $134.2 million the previous year.
- The company's Satellite and Space segment reported a 25% sequential increase in net sales, while the Terrestrial and Wireless segment saw a 5% decrease year-over-year.
- This was attributed to the company's comprehensive transformation plan, including operational improvements, strategic alternatives review, and capital structure enhancements.
Operational Efficiency and Cost Reduction:
- Comtech's Satellite and Space Communications segment improved its gross margin, contributing to an overall 26.7% consolidated gross margin.
- The segment's operational efficiency improved, including a 10%+ reduction in staff, product rationalization, and enhanced purchasing and inventory management.
- The improvements were part of the company's efforts to reduce costs and improve efficiency across business units.
Strategic Initiatives and Business Growth:
- The company awarded $40 million in new subordinated debt, aiming to improve financial flexibility and support strategic initiatives.
- Comtech engaged external firms to explore strategic alternatives for both the Terrestrial and Wireless business and the Satellite and Space business.
- These initiatives are part of a broader strategy to enhance shareholder value and focus on high-margin business opportunities.
Terrestrial and Wireless Network Expansion:
- The Terrestrial and Wireless segment signed a contract with Vodafone, with potential expansion to 30+ regions, indicating growth opportunities in international markets.
- Comtech's CLT division secured a $8 million contract with Polaris, showcasing the potential of location-based technologies.
- These developments reflect the company's strategic focus on expanding its reach within the global wireless carrier market.
